I have an RS2BL080 (e or d? spec... the one that supports encryption key management) which has an LSI SAS2108* RAID-on-Chip setup.

 

Are TRIM and\or RST features which these cards already support (and I've just missed it)?

OR will Intel update the drives and software for these cards\chips?
